Any kites flyers here? by JimK 2008-08-26 02:58:15
A colleague lent me a Flexifoil Sting (1.7m model) over the weekend, and I'm hooked.

First time with a four-line kite, and it took a couple of minutes to get the hang of it. After that, smiles all the way. Really easy to fly, great to turn with the brakes. After landing it leading edge first, I managed to use the brake to flip it upright and take off. Finished with a neat landing.

Fantastic. I'm now wondering how to afford one of my own :-)
